I've been "agonizing" over a purchase decision since January, 2019; when I first came across information about the upcoming release
of both the Telluride and the Palisade.

I test drove a Telluride last March, went to the NYC Auto Show to see and compare the Palisade and Telluride;
probably watched every video review available on the internet.


For a good while the Telluride was in the lead; I was leery of the Palisade push-button transmission and it's rather large front grill.

I became a member of Telluride Forums, Palisade Forums and the FaceBook group for each vehicle to keep tabs on owners' feedback.

As, with any vehicle; each had tales of issues (wind noise, windshield cracks, electronics glitches, etc.) and that was the main reason to delay a purchase.

However, my '03 Suburban had me troubled; I felt it was time to act before something major broke down.


Yesterday, I leased a white Palisade SE.

Ultimately chose the Palisade because I feel it has the higher quality finishing.


This is my first time leasing and also the first time buying a white vehicle.


Only been one day, but absolutely no regrets with the decision.


I plan is to either purchase or lease an SEL Palisade at the end of the lease.


Although I opted for the base version, the seats will be changed over to heated seats by the dealership next week.

Some comforts are just "necessary"
